Description
This French wooden refectory table dates from the 19th century. The chunky top stands on a substantial base which is structurally sound. A rustic design raised on straight legs, united by a central 'H'-shaped refectory stretcher. The straight legs, which are ridged on one side, are simplistic in form and balance the table wonderfully. The two longitudinal sides of the tabletop are decorative hand-carved. The table features a dark patina, grown rich through years of use. Along the top you will see old cracks, minor gouges, and discolouration/lighter areas all adding to its character while revealing the generations of use this table received. Nevertheless, the table is in excellent original condition.
A table full of charm and authenticity, displaying a warm and rich patina throughout. A striking design that would lend itself well to many interiors. This dining table will comfortably seat 6 to 8 people. -
